Recently I purchased an item and used the Paypal checkout option in which my Visa card was linked too.
The product turned out to be defective.
In the meantime my banking institutioin closed down hence closing my account and my visa card.
I recevied a refund from the product vendor which was directed to paypal
Paypal directed this to my bank account (now closed)
The company now in charge of my old bank confirmed that the funds where returned / chargedback to Paypal.
Paypal will not help in finding these funds.
The bank has confirmed the money no longer with them it is with Paypal
I have rung paypal multiple times and they simply do not understand what I am trying to get to they confirm that the refund was successful but will not look for the money since charged back.
Can somebody advise?

If the card ACCOUNT that both cards belong or belonged to is still open then it should go through fine.
However if its a completely new card / account then it may decline so ask your old card issuer if they can help you recover your refund.
